[
http://jira.amdatu.org/jira/browse/AMDATU-318?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
]
Ivo Ladage - van Doorn reopened AMDATU-318:
-------------------------------------------
After updating replication factor to 2 and restart of node 2, I get this error:
[2011-03-10 11:52:47] WARNING: Invocation of 'start' failed.
[org.amdatu.example.course.service]
null
java.lang.NullPointerException
at
org.amdatu.example.course.service.service.ProfileDataProvider.createTestPersons(ProfileDataProvider.java:83)
at
org.amdatu.example.course.service.service.ProfileDataProvider.start(ProfileDataProvider.java:51)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at
s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
at
s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:597)
at
org.apache.felix.dm.InvocationUtil.invokeMethod(InvocationUtil.java:45)
at
org.apache.felix.dm.InvocationUtil.invokeCallbackMethod(InvocationUtil.java:13)
at
org.apache.felix.dm.impl.ComponentImpl.invokeCallbackMethod(ComponentImpl.java:684)
at org.apache.felix.dm.impl.ComponentImpl.invoke(ComponentImpl.java:675)
at
org.apache.felix.dm.impl.ComponentImpl.bindService(ComponentImpl.java:620)
at
org.apache.felix.dm.impl.ComponentImpl.access$400(ComponentImpl.java:52)
at org.apache.felix.dm.impl.ComponentImpl$7.run(ComponentImpl.java:178)
at org.apache.felix.dm.impl.SerialExecutor$1.run(SerialExecutor.java:47)
at
org.apache.felix.dm.impl.SerialExecutor.scheduleNext(SerialExecutor.java:84)
at
org.apache.felix.dm.impl.SerialExecutor.access$000(SerialExecutor.java:33)
at org.apache.felix.dm.impl.SerialExecutor$1.run(SerialExecutor.java:50)
at
org.apache.felix.dm.impl.SerialExecutor.scheduleNext(SerialExecutor.java:84)
at
org.apache.felix.dm.impl.SerialExecutor.access$000(SerialExecutor.java:33)
at org.apache.felix.dm.impl.SerialExecutor$1.run(SerialExecutor.java:50)
at
org.apache.felix.dm.impl.SerialExecutor.scheduleNext(SerialExecutor.java:84)
at
org.apache.felix.dm.impl.SerialExecutor.execute(SerialExecutor.java:68)
at
org.apache.felix.dm.impl.ComponentImpl.calculateStateChanges(ComponentImpl.java:228)
at org.apache.felix.dm.impl.ComponentImpl.start(ComponentImpl.java:406)
at org.apache.felix.dm.DependencyManager.add(DependencyManager.java:81)
at
org.amdatu.example.course.service.osgi.Activator.initWithDependencies(Activator.java:86)
at
org.amdatu.libraries.utilities.osgi.ServiceDependentActivator$SpiWatcher.start(ServiceDependentActivat
> Tombstones out of sync on node B in Cassandra cluster when they are removed
> from node A during downtime of node B
> -----------------------------------------------------------------------------------------------------------------
>
> Key: AMDATU-318
> URL: http://jira.amdatu.org/jira/browse/AMDATU-318
> Project: Amdatu
> Issue Type: Bug
> Components: Amdatu Cassandra
> Affects Versions: 0.2.0
> Reporter: Ivo Ladage - van Doorn
> Assignee: Ivo Ladage - van Doorn
> Fix For: 0.1.1
>
>
> First setup a Cassandra cluster as described in this use case:
> http://www.amdatu.org/confluence/display/Amdatu/Use+case+2
> Assume that node A is the seed (master) of node B.
> Now to reproduce:
> - Open dashboards of node A and B, login as Administrator and add UserAdmin
> gadget
> - Add a user '01' on node A (using UserAdmin gagdet), note that it appears on
> node B
> - Stop node B
> - Create another user '02' on node A
> - Remove user '01' on node A
> - Start node B
> Now note that user '02' is now available on node B, but also user '01' is
> still present, which should have been removed (upon Hinted handoff and read
> repair).
> Also tried removing the users using cassandra-cli instead, but the result is
> the same.
--
This message is automatically generated by JIRA.
For more information on JIRA, see: http://www.atlassian.com/software/jira
_______________________________________________
Amdatu-developers mailing list
[email protected]
http://lists.amdatu.org/mailman/listinfo/amdatu-developers